Nick Saban Jr. ( born October 31, 1951)[3] is an American football coach who has been the head football coach at the University of Alabama since 2007. Saban previously served as the head coach of the National Football League. Miami Dolphins and at three other universities: Louisiana State University (LSU), Michigan State University and the University of Toledo. Saban is considered by many to be the greatest coach in college football history.

After playing a defensive role at Kent State from 1970–1972, Nick Saban began his coaching career as a graduate assistant at Kent State from 1973–1974. Over the next nine years, Saban held linebacker and defensive back position coaching titles at Kent State, Syracuse, West Virginia, Ohio State, and the Navy. From 1983–1987, Saban served as the defensive coordinator and defensive backs coach at Michigan State. Saban made the jump to the NFL in 1988, serving as a defensive back coach for the Houston Oilers for two seasons.
